Unprecedented Response to Online Grievance Meeting Organized by PR&RD Department

Hyderabad.24.01.2025: The Panchayat Raj and Rural Development (PRRD) Department organized its first-ever online grievance meeting to address employee and service-related issues. The innovative initiative, led by Minister Seethakka, received an overwhelming response from employees who freely voiced their concerns for two hours.

Employees Freely Express Problems

Panchayat secretaries, field assistants, and other staff shared their challenges with Minister Seethakka and senior officials, including MPDOs, DPOs, engineers, DRDO staff, and others. Key issues raised included promotions, transfers, office expenses, increments, and pending PRC matters. Employees also highlighted concerns such as ad hoc promotions, recognition of record assistants as junior assistants, gazetted status for grade panchayat secretaries, spouse transfers, and enhanced accident insurance for NREGA APOs.

Officials Listen and Act

Minister Seethakka, along with Secretary Lokesh Kumar, Director Srujana, and ENCs Kripakar Reddy and Kanakaratnam, attentively heard the grievances. They assured quick resolution of issues within their jurisdiction and promised to escalate policy-level matters to higher authorities. Some requests that were deemed unfeasible were rejected on the spot.

Employees expressed gratitude for the online grievance mechanism, appreciating the opportunity to report issues without visiting the Secretariat. They thanked Minister Seethakka for initiating this innovative approach.

Minister Seethakka’s Commitment

Minister Seethakka, known for her dedication to public service, addressed the grievances even during her journey to Mulugu for the Governor’s visit. She emphasized that the government is committed to resolving employee issues swiftly.

“We are adopting innovative methods to address PRRD department problems. Decisions that can be made at the department level will be implemented immediately. Matters requiring cabinet approval will be taken up promptly. Employee files should not be kept pending, and we will support employees in every way possible,” said Minister Seethakka.

She also warned against misuse of power, highlighting instances of negligence, such as cutting pensions without discretion. She assured strict action, including suspension, against officials found guilty of deliberate mistakes.
